How can I best shoot portraits with only two lights?

    https://photo.stackexchange.com/questions/19177/how-can-i-best-shoot-portraits-with-only-two-lights
    Two light setup #1 (Key + Fill ) This is a very common setup, where you put one light directly behind the camera to provide fill (nice even light over your subject). Being directly behind the camera, it will light all areas of the subject visible to the camera and will not result in any visible shadows on the background.
